Anthropic has announced the research preview of Claude Tag, a new feature that embeds an AI assistant directly into Slack workflows. Users can simply @mention Claude in a chat to call on this "always-on" AI teammate, gaining real-time insights, assigning tasks, or picking up conversations where they left off. The feature is available for Claude Enterprise and Claude Team customers and is currently in research preview.
Unlike previous integrations that only supported private messages or one-off requests, Claude Tag gives everyone in the same Slack channel access to a shared Claude identity. This means "anyone can see what Claude is working on and continue the conversation from where a colleague left off." System admins can fine-tune which tools, information, and channels Claude can access—for example, a Claude identity configured for the legal team won't be able to read engineering channel memories, ensuring data isolation and security. Additionally, the Claude Code feature can route coding tasks from a channel to a full coding session on the web, then return the results back to the original discussion thread.
